Differences between brazil nut and maple syrup

  • Brazil nut has more selenium, copper, phosphorus, magnesium, vitamin B1, vitamin E, and fiber, while maple syrup has more vitamin B2 and manganese.
  • Brazil nut's daily need coverage for selenium is 3484% higher.
  • The amount of saturated fat in maple syrup is lower.
  • Brazil nut has a lower glycemic index. The glycemic index of brazil nut is 10, while the glycemic index of maple syrup is 54.

The food types used in this comparison are Nuts, brazilnuts, dried, unblanched and Syrups, maple.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Brazil nut Maple syrup DV% diff.
Selenium 1917µg 0.6µg 3484%
Copper 1.743mg 0.018mg 192%
Polyunsaturated fat 24.399g 0.017g 163%
Fats 67.1g 0.06g 103%
Phosphorus 725mg 2mg 103%
Vitamin B2 0.035mg 1.27mg 95%
Magnesium 376mg 21mg 85%
Saturated fat 16.134g 0.007g 73%
Manganese 1.223mg 2.908mg 73%
Monounsaturated fat 23.879g 0.011g 60%
Vitamin B1 0.617mg 0.066mg 46%
Vitamin E 5.65mg 0mg 38%
Fiber 7.5g 0g 30%
Protein 14.32g 0.04g 29%
Iron 2.43mg 0.11mg 29%
Zinc 4.06mg 1.47mg 24%
Calories 659kcal 260kcal 20%
Carbs 11.74g 67.04g 18%
Potassium 659mg 212mg 13%
Vitamin B6 0.101mg 0.002mg 8%
Calcium 160mg 102mg 6%
Folate 22µg 0µg 6%
Choline 28.8mg 1.6mg 5%
Vitamin B5 0.184mg 0.036mg 3%
Fructose 0g 0.52g 1%
Vitamin B3 0.295mg 0.081mg 1%
Vitamin C 0.7mg 0mg 1%
Net carbs 4.24g 67.04g N/A
Sugar 2.33g 60.46g N/A
